When it comes to compensation versions, many accident attorneys service a contingency cost basis. This indicates that the hurt client pays absolutely nothing to the attorney upfront. The legal representative only gets paid if he/she does well in recuperating financial compensation for the customer's accident claim. For example, if you're hurt in a cars and truck mishap, a legal representative might take 30% of your settlement if you win. This plan permits you to concentrate on recovery without bothering with immediate legal expenditures.

A lot of injury attorneys take between 33% and 40% of a settlement, depending upon the complexity and stage of the situation. Considering that they service a contingency basis, you don't need to pay anything ahead of time-- they only get paid if you win.
